Abstract
The utility model discloses a rolled paper tube with two tail filament grooves. The rolled paper tube mainly comprises a paper tube, wherein a first filament groove is formed at the end part of the paper tube, and the second filament groove is formed on the paper tube and on the symmetry plane of the first filament groove. Compared with the prior art, the rolled paper tube provided by the utility model is characterized in that the second filament groove is additionally formed on the symmetry plane of the first filament groove of the paper tube, so as to form the fully-automatic rolled paper tube with the two tail filament grooves; when being switched, filament bundles are firstly cut into the first tail filament groove, and then continue to enter into the second tail filament groove if the first filament groove fails to enable that the filament bundles to be smoothly embedded into for some reason, so that the switching efficiency is greatly improved, and achieves the effect that the paper tube with one tail filament groove fails. The rolled paper tube disclosed by the utility model has the advantages that not only the consumption and the manufacturing cost are reduced, but also the labor intensity of operators can be reduced; and meanwhile, PFY (Polyester Filament Yarn) production is stabilized and product quality is greatly improved.
